When I was a young teacher working in a school, I used to dream of driving beautiful trucks around the world.... One of the many problems holding me back was that I didn’t see truck driving as a profession with great prospects or social respect.... But then I met a very successful man who told me ’The most important thing in life is to do what makes you happy. Don’t pay attention how prestigious the profession is. If you love cleaning, be a cleaner! Grow in your profession, learn all the time and clean like nobody else cleans! If you love to drive, be a driver the world never seen been before, and you never know where the road will take you! Just learn something new every day. Do the best you can!’ Years ago I really did not associate this profession with self development. Today I know I was wrong. You don’t have to be a trucker for life.
